from flask import Flask, jsonify
# import templates
from flask import render_template, request
import boto3
import botocore
from botocore import exceptions
app = Flask(__name__, static_url_path='/static')
@app.route('/')
def index():
return render_template('index.html')
access_key = ''
secret_key = ''
region = ''
client = ''
ec2 = ''
ami_id = 'ami-cdbdd7a2'
import data
userdata = data.testData
@app.route('/aws', methods=['GET','POST'])
def aws():
if request.method == 'POST':
global access_key, secret_key, region
access_key = request.form['access_key']
secret_key = request.form['secret_key']
region = request.form['region']
# check login
try:
global client
client = boto3.client('ec2', aws_access_key_id=access_key, aws_secret_access_key=secret_key,
region_name=region)
region_list = client.describe_regions()
return render_template('aws_home.html')
except botocore.exceptions.ClientError as e:
return render_template('denide.html')
else:
return render_template('aws.html')
@app.route('/aws_ec2', methods=['GET','POST'])
def aws_ec2():
if request.method == 'POST':
server_type = request.form['server_type']
environment = request.form['environment']
key_name = request.form['key_name']
security_group = request.form['security_group']
# No use if security group provided.
subnet_id = request.form['subnet_id']
instance_type = request.form['instance_type']
instance_count = int(request.form['instance_count'])
global ec2
ec2 = boto3.resource('ec2', aws_access_key_id=access_key, aws_secret_access_key=secret_key, region_name=region)
instances = ec2.create_instances(
ImageId=ami_id,
MinCount=1,
MaxCount=instance_count,
KeyName=key_name,
SecurityGroups=[
security_group,
],
UserData=userdata,
InstanceType=instance_type
)
mytag = [{
'Key': 'Name',
'Value': environment + '_' + server_type
}]
for instance in instances:
ec2.create_tags(
Resources=[
instance.id,
],
Tags=mytag
)
return render_template('aws_home.html', aws_ec2=environment)
else:
key_pair = [key_pair['KeyName'] for key_pair in client.describe_key_pairs()['KeyPairs']]
securitygroup = [securitygroup['GroupName'] for securitygroup in client.describe_security_groups()['SecurityGroups']]
# subnet = [subnet['SubnetId'] for subnet in client.describe_subnets()['Subnets']]
vpc = [vpc['VpcId'] for vpc in client.describe_vpcs()['Vpcs']]
return render_template('aws_ec2.html', key_pairs=key_pair, securitygroups=securitygroup, vpcs=vpc)
# return render_template('test.html', vpcs=vpc)
@app.route('/_parse_data', methods=['GET'])
def parse_data():
if request.method == "GET":
# only need the id we grabbed in my case.
id = request.args.get('a', 0, type=str)
print id
response = client.describe_subnets(
Filters=[
{
'Name': 'vpc-id',
'Values': [
id,
]
}
]
)
print response
new_list = [new_list['SubnetId'] for new_list in response['Subnets']]
return jsonify(new_list)
@app.route('/aws_vpc', methods=['GET','POST'])
def aws_vpc():
if request.method == 'POST':
vpc_name=request.form['vpc_name']
cidr_block=request.form['cidr_block']
environment = 'dev'
# ec2 = boto3.resource('ec2', aws_access_key_id=access_key, aws_secret_access_key=secret_key, region_name=region)
vpcs = ec2.create_vpc(
CidrBlock = cidr_block,
InstanceTenancy = 'default',
AmazonProvidedIpv6CidrBlock = False
)
mytag = [{
'Key': 'Name',
'Value': environment + '_' + vpc_name
}]
ec2.create_tags(
Resources=[
vpcs.id,
],
Tags=mytag
)
return render_template('aws_home.html')
else:
return render_template('aws_vpc.html')
from aws_vpc import aws_vpc_blueprint
app.register_blueprint(aws_vpc_blueprint)
if __name__ == '__main__':
app.run()
